Depending on the amount of spikes in their hair, cutting a body takes anywhere between an hour and a half and three hours. I think. I often lose track of time;) I do know that the preparations take longer, I'm sure you recognize some of these steps: deciding the right shape, finding a good reference, getting the bodies to look like THEM, sketching and resketching. Then remembering I have to make a mirror image if I want to cut them as I imagined them so the final step is tracing the original sketch for a decent cutting shape. After cutting the outline of the bodies, I also spend a lot of time figuring out which details to cut without losing any fatal parts; I almost cut off Jeff's butt! O_o

Sketching is the most frustrating thing. I do make a manip in Photoshop first to get the position to my liking. Bodies are hard!

Playing with the light is my reward for the time I spent sitting still and having to focus on not fucking up the cutting;)

I'm so happy the screen image works as a background, I was very excited to try that and admittedly quite pleased with myself when I came up with that. I always try to come up with ways to work with what I got around the house.
That's also how I started the paper-cut art (with Jeff and the cupcakes;) I had grown a little bored with doing yet another digital design and was inspired Gishwesh to do some hands-on creating with materials I had collected in my arts & crafts closet (I told you before that I was a horder of random materials for our Sinterklaas surprises) I found a lot of coloured paper and I just wanted to DO something with that.
